Illusion of Hermann-Goering The effect of physiological nystagmus. If you stare at a black dot, trying not to take your eyes off it, then after about 30 seconds, the black and white parts of the image will begin to oscillate. If you then look at the white dot, you can see a set of white squares on a black background (i.e., a consistent image) superimposed on the real drawing. This consistent image will move around the drawing all the time, no matter how hard you try to keep it in place.

Disappearing Spots You see a circle of blue-violet spots that disappear in turn, as if moving in a circle. Direct your gaze to the crosshairs in the center, while watching with peripheral vision as the spots disappear. If you do everything right, you will see that a green spot is moving in a circle. Do not look away, and after a while the purple spots will disappear completely, and only the green running in a circle will remain!
